HOW YOU WILL CONTRIBUTE
This software development position is focused on auditing and compliance systems development, architecture, integrations, workflows, and administration delivering the overall platform and portfolio.
RESPONSIBILITES:
Develop and maintain scripts using Perl (primarily), as well as, Python, Shell Scripting, and Ansible to automate infrastructure systems auditing
Lead or participate in code reviews, design reviews, offering guidance on best practices to continuously improve stability and efficiencies
Design, develop, and enhance applications on the Auditing & Compliance platform
Build and maintain RESTful services using Python (Bottle framework) for data integration
Package and deploy audit tools (RPM) for scalable, automated data collection across diverse hosts
Maintain dashboards and audit databases to support real-time compliance monitoring
Diagnose and resolve performance bottlenecks in databases and system processes
Expand and refine auditing clients, ensuring seamless data ingestion and feature growth
Support asset compliance initiatives and assist users in identifying and resolving gaps
Drive platform evolution with a focus on scalability, security, and integration with adjacent systems
Lead root-cause analysis and implement durable solutions to improve system health
Maintain clear, up-to-date technical documentation to support ongoing development and operations
